Abstract

In order to investigate the effect of different starch raw materials on pullulan biosynthesis by Aureobasidium pullulans, the starch derived from such crops as cassava, corn, potato, sweet potato and wheat was separately used as carbon source for fermentative production of pullulan polysaccharide. The results showed that cassava starch was beneficial to the biosynthesis of pullulan polysaccharide, and the maximum pullulan yield of 23.96 g/L was obtained.
